That is false. The Gen 2 decks are made by Panasonic (even the "JBL" version). I'm not sure about Gen 1 though... Many Toyotas do have decks manufactured by Fujitsu Ten, the parent company of Eclipse, but that still doesn't enable aftermarket Eclipse decks to be compatable.
The steering wheel controls are hard wired from the factory, and very few aftermarket units have any receptical/wiring for such a connection, no matter what the brand.
The PAC control units splice into the steering wheel control wiring and send a signal to a remote eye located elsewhere in your car (in the case of the PAC SWI-X the signal can be programmed for any manufacturer). So, basically, it acts as a remote control and requires that your headunit is remote compatable...
If you have a headunit that is not remote control compatable, you're pretty much SOL...
